    What is a Lego Table?

    A Lego table is a piece of furniture specifically designed for building with LEGO bricks. It provides a dedicated, organized space for children to engage in creative play. These tables often feature a building surface, such as a LEGO-compatible baseplate, and may include built-in storage solutions for bricks and accessories. The purpose of a Lego table is to contain the play area, making cleanup easier and preventing the loss of small pieces.

    Benefits of a Lego Table

    Organization and Cleanup: The most significant benefit is containing the mess. With designated storage and a building surface, bricks are less likely to end up scattered across the floor.

    Encourages Creativity: A dedicated space for building can inspire more frequent and focused play. It signals to a child that this area is for them to create and build.

    Ergonomic Design: Many tables are designed at a child-friendly height, allowing them to stand or sit comfortably while building, which promotes better posture than playing on the floor.

    Longevity: A quality Lego table can grow with a child. It can be a simple play surface for toddlers and a complex building station for older kids.

    Multifunctionality: Some tables have a reversible top, allowing them to be used as a regular table for drawing, homework, or other activities when not in use for LEGOs.

    Types of Lego Tables

    There’s a wide range of Lego tables available to suit different needs and budgets.

    Simple Play Tables: These are often small, lightweight tables with a single building plate on top. They are great for small spaces or as a starter table.

    Tables with Built-in Storage: These are a step up, featuring drawers, bins, or nets underneath the table to store bricks. This is essential for keeping a collection organized.

    Activity Tables: These are more elaborate, with multiple building plates, storage compartments, and sometimes even chairs included. They are designed to be the central hub of a play room.

    DIY Lego Tables: For the hands-on parent, a DIY table can be a great, cost-effective option. This involves taking an existing table and adding a building surface and storage.

    How to Choose the Right Lego Table

    When selecting a Lego table, consider these factors:

    Size and Space: How much space do you have? Measure the area where the table will go to ensure a good fit.

    Age of the Child: For younger children, a table with rounded corners and a low height is safer. For older kids, a larger surface area might be needed for bigger builds.

    Storage Needs: If you have a large LEGO collection, a table with ample storage is a must. Consider how you want to organize the bricks—by color, size, or set.

    Material and Durability: Look for sturdy materials like solid wood or high-quality plastic. The building plate should be securely attached and durable.

    Budget: Lego tables range widely in price. Set a budget before you start shopping.

    DIY Lego Table: A Step-by-Step Guide

    If you’re a DIY enthusiast, creating your own Lego table can be a rewarding project.

    Materials Needed:

    An existing table (a coffee table, side table, or children’s table works well).

    LEGO baseplates (the number and size will depend on the table).

    Strong adhesive (like construction adhesive or a strong double-sided tape designed for plastic and wood).

    Optional: Storage containers, drawers, or fabric nets for storage.

    Instructions:

    Prepare the Surface: Clean the top of the table thoroughly to ensure the adhesive will stick.

    Measure and Arrange: Lay out the baseplates on the table to determine the best arrangement. Make sure they fit snugly and cover the desired area.

    Attach the Baseplates: Apply the adhesive to the back of the baseplates and carefully press them onto the table. Apply even pressure and let the adhesive cure according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

    Add Storage (Optional): Attach storage solutions under the table. You can use bins, hooks, or a fabric net to create a place for bricks.

    FAQs

    How do you clean a Lego table?

     Use a damp cloth to wipe down the surface. For deep cleaning, you can use a mild soap and water solution, but avoid using harsh chemicals. Make sure the table is completely dry before playing with bricks again.

    Can I use non-Lego brand bricks on a Lego table?

     Most Lego-compatible baseplates are designed to work with other major brick brands. However, it’s always a good idea to check the product description to confirm compatibility.

    What’s the best way to store bricks on a Lego table? 

    The best way is to use a storage system that works for you. Options include sorting by color, type of brick, or storing all bricks in a large bin. Many tables have built-in drawers or nets that make organization easy.

    Are Lego tables just for kids? 

    Not at all! Many adults who are avid LEGO builders use Lego tables to create intricate and large-scale models. They provide a stable, dedicated workspace.

    How can I make a Lego table more engaging for my child?

    You can make it more engaging by adding different types of baseplates (like road plates or green grass plates), incorporating themed storage, or displaying finished models on the table.

    Final Thoughts

    A Lego table can be a fantastic addition to any playroom or bedroom, offering a dedicated and organized space for creative building. It helps in keeping the house tidy while encouraging a child’s imagination and focus. Whether you buy one or make one yourself, it’s an investment in a child’s play and development.
